In December of 2012, the Dedham Sustainability Advisory Committee created the Dedham Solar Challenge. This program encouraged the 900 homes in Dedham suitable for solar to receive a free solar assessment and find out about going solar in their homes for little or no-cost. The results have been impressive: over 70 homes have had the assessment and 27 homes have decided to install panels on their roofs. All participants earned a $50 gift card to Legacy Place and homes which install panels will earn the Town $250 to use toward sustainability programs for all to enjoy like a public gardening program.


All attendees will also learn how to improve the energy efficiency of their home through the no -cost energy assessment. These no-cost energy assessments provide a comprehensive home energy assessment, instant savings measures, free air sealing, and 75% off insulation up to $2,000 per year!
